Oracle Java EE实训:MySQL数据库设计与开发详解
需积分: 10 154 浏览量
更新于2024-07-18
收藏 1.24MB PDF 举报
"Oracle Java EE实训教材系列 数据库的设计与开发"主要涵盖了关于MySQL数据库的深入学习,包括从基础的MySQL介绍、客户端工具、数据查询、数据类型到复杂的数据库设计和事务处理等内容,旨在帮助读者掌握数据库开发的核心技能。
本教材详细介绍了MySQL的起源和演变历程,MySQL作为一款由MySQLAB公司创建的开源RDBMS,因其易用性、高效性和高可靠性而广受欢迎。随着Sun Microsystems和Oracle公司的收购,MySQL成为了Oracle产品线的一部分。教材涵盖了MySQL的主要产品,如企业服务器、社区服务器、嵌入式数据库和集群,以及相应的图形用户界面工具,如MySQL移植工具包、MySQL Administrator和MySQL Query Browser,这些工具为数据库管理和查询提供了便利。
在技术层面,教材详细讲解了MySQL的数据类型、SQL表达式、数据库和表的创建与操作,这些都是数据库设计的基础。对于查询操作,教材详细阐述了如何使用SQL进行表数据查询,包括选择、投影、连接和分组等操作。事务处理是保证数据库一致性的重要概念,教材中的第十章对此进行了讲解,包括事务的ACID特性、提交、回滚和隔离级别等。视图的使用能够简化复杂查询,提高数据安全性,教材也对其进行了讨论。此外,教材还提到了存储引擎,如InnoDB和MyISAM,这是影响数据库性能的关键因素。
在编程方面,教材提到了MySQL的多种驱动程序或连接器,如MySQL CAPI、ODBC、JDBC、Net和PHP,这些连接器使得多种编程语言可以与MySQL数据库进行交互,为开发者提供了灵活的选择。
在实际操作部分,教材指导读者如何从MySQL官网下载并安装MySQL数据库服务器,包括对不同操作系统(如Windows)的安装步骤说明,为读者提供了动手实践的机会。
通过这本教材的学习,读者不仅可以了解MySQL的基本概念和技术,还能掌握实际操作技能,为从事Oracle Java EE环境下的数据库设计与开发打下坚实基础。
2016-11-17 上传
145 浏览量
2010-12-16 上传
139 浏览量
2024-06-27 上传
153 浏览量
点击了解资源详情
点击了解资源详情
点击了解资源详情
PeterChu_txj
- 粉丝: 4
最新资源
- 华为编程规范与实践指南
- 电脑键盘快捷键全解析:速成操作指南
- 优化JFC/Swing数据模型:减少耦合与提高效率
- JavaServerPages基础教程 - 初学者入门
- Vim 7.2用户手册:实践为王,提升编辑技能
- 莱昂氏UNIX源代码分析 - 深入操作系统经典解读
- 提高单片机编程效率:C51编译器中文手册详解
- SEO魔法书:提升搜索引擎排名的秘籍
- Linux Video4Linux驱动详解:USB摄像头的内核支持与应用编程
- ArcIMS Java Connector二次开发指南
- Java实现汉诺塔算法详解
- ArcGISServer入门指南:打造企业级Web GIS
- 从零开始:探索计算机与系统开发的发现之旅
- 理解硬件描述语言(HDL):附录A
- ArcGIS开发指南:ArcObjects与AML基础编程
- 深入浅出Linux:RedHat命令手册解析